"I just never felt like I fit there," she said. "Most people are like oh, it's because you're a freshman and you're not playing very well, but I can't use that excuse. That's when I knew it wasn't right. All this stuff is so perfect, why do I still feel that way?

"I just think that, I wouldn't say the way they play, but the way they went about things on the court and their style of basketball. It wasn't me and wasn't what I've been about with basketball."

It wasn't about distance from family in Idaho, she reiterated.

That was a nice article. I get the sense she just wasn't quite ready for the entire culture shock. High School to College. Small Town Idaho to College Park Maryland. Being so far away from home. No longer being the center of attention. Nothing wrong with that at 18.

It sounds likes she is settling in and she is enjoying the year off while getting acclimated to a different phase of life. That was the old concept in not allowing freshman to play. It is great to hear no negativity from either her or Frese about the transfer. She should be a great addition to the Pac 12 talent pool next season.
